SummaryIn real-time, the story takes us through a little over an hour and a half of a young woman's day as she waits and waits and waits in a lovely restaurant for Gene to arrive for their critical third date. As the clock ticks away and Gene is nowhere to be found, Audrey is swept up into an incredibly rich journey through her life as her insecurities ... Read More
